Hancock's Half Hour: Specials
Welcome to London
0:00 am
Sunday, 3 August 1958
This 9 minute programme was originally part of a live BBC Broadcast from the London Coliseum to entertain athletes in the capital on their way home from the British Empire and Commonwealth Games held in Cardiff from 18th - 26th July 1958 and is introduced by Kenneth Horne. The performance was part of a week of activities put on for athletes coming through London.The programme was only broadcast once and was subsequently wiped by the BBC. This off-air recording was found amongst the vast quantity of recordings made by Bob Monkhouse and received its second broadcast in July 2012, to welcome the athletes for the London 2012 Olympics.
Cast Tony Hancock, Sidney James, Bill Kerr and introduced by Kenneth Horne
